Transaction 23833113098080f165282bb67039efe547b4c04a16d81471fe987c0f90239ee0
1 Input
2 Outputs
- 23833113098080f165282bb67039efe547b4c04a16d81471fe987c0f90239ee0:0
- 23833113098080f165282bb67039efe547b4c04a16d81471fe987c0f90239ee0:1
value 2072411
address 1QDKP94uaXWUW7mEhKXM8cd4efjxHRMRSv
value 1611373
address 14mbTdswF3WktHMoKEBT6YK5jPfKChT8NV